ToolMatter
Your Apps in Action
Risersoft
Buy
Try
Explore
Documentation
Public
Use this form to visualize Schema for codeship-steps.yml files..
{{repoTitle.MainEntity}}
name - The name of the step. Can be omitted.
type - The type of the step. If omitted, defaults to 'run'
tag - A pattern matching tags or branches this step and any of its children should be run against. Defaults to always running.
exclude - A pattern matching tags or branches on which this step should NOT be run. Defaults to empty.
service - The service name defined in codeship-services.yml this step will run on
command - The command to be run in this step. Required with and can only be used with the 'run' type or no specified type
image_name - The image name this push step should push to. Required with and only used by the push step
image_tag - The image tag this push step should push to. See https://docs.cloudbees.com/docs/cloudbees-codeship/latest/pro-builds-and-configuration/steps#_push_steps for details. Only used by the push step
registry - The image registry this push step should push to. For Docker Hub, use https://registry-1.docker.io. Required with and only used by the push step
encrypted_dockercfg_path - The location of a Docker configuration file encrypted by Jet to be used with this step. Optional.
dockercfg_service - The name of a service defined in codeship-services.yml that provides the Docker configuration. Optional.
services A list of service names defined in codeship-services.yml that will be used for this step.
#
Values
Actions
{{$index+1}}.
steps A list of steps to run within this step or on_fail group. Cannot be used with 'run', 'push', or 'load' steps
#
name
type
tag
exclude
service
command
image_name
image_tag
registry
encrypted_dockercfg_path
Actions
{{$index+1}}.
{{row.name}}
{{row.type}}
{{row.tag}}
{{row.exclude}}
{{row.service}}
{{row.command}}
{{row.image_name}}
{{row.image_tag}}
{{row.registry}}
{{row.encrypted_dockercfg_path}}
on_fail An optional list of steps to run if this step fails.
#
name
type
tag
exclude
service
command
image_name
image_tag
registry
encrypted_dockercfg_path
Actions
{{$index+1}}.
{{row.name}}
{{row.type}}
{{row.tag}}
{{row.exclude}}
{{row.service}}
{{row.command}}
{{row.image_name}}
{{row.image_tag}}
{{row.registry}}
{{row.encrypted_dockercfg_path}}
{{repoTitle.MainEntity}}
name - The name of the step. Can be omitted.
type - The type of the step. If omitted, defaults to 'run'
tag - A pattern matching tags or branches this step and any of its children should be run against. Defaults to always running.
exclude - A pattern matching tags or branches on which this step should NOT be run. Defaults to empty.
service - The service name defined in codeship-services.yml this step will run on
command - The command to be run in this step. Required with and can only be used with the 'run' type or no specified type
image_name - The image name this push step should push to. Required with and only used by the push step
image_tag - The image tag this push step should push to. See https://docs.cloudbees.com/docs/cloudbees-codeship/latest/pro-builds-and-configuration/steps#_push_steps for details. Only used by the push step
registry - The image registry this push step should push to. For Docker Hub, use https://registry-1.docker.io. Required with and only used by the push step
encrypted_dockercfg_path - The location of a Docker configuration file encrypted by Jet to be used with this step. Optional.
dockercfg_service - The name of a service defined in codeship-services.yml that provides the Docker configuration. Optional.
services A list of service names defined in codeship-services.yml that will be used for this step.
#
Values
Actions
{{$index+1}}.
steps A list of steps to run within this step or on_fail group. Cannot be used with 'run', 'push', or 'load' steps
#
name
type
tag
exclude
service
command
image_name
image_tag
registry
encrypted_dockercfg_path
Actions
{{$index+1}}.
{{row.name}}
{{row.type}}
{{row.tag}}
{{row.exclude}}
{{row.service}}
{{row.command}}
{{row.image_name}}
{{row.image_tag}}
{{row.registry}}
{{row.encrypted_dockercfg_path}}
on_fail An optional list of steps to run if this step fails.
#
name
type
tag
exclude
service
command
image_name
image_tag
registry
encrypted_dockercfg_path
Actions
{{$index+1}}.
{{row.name}}
{{row.type}}
{{row.tag}}
{{row.exclude}}
{{row.service}}
{{row.command}}
{{row.image_name}}
{{row.image_tag}}
{{row.registry}}
{{row.encrypted_dockercfg_path}}
{{repoTitle.MainEntity}}
name - The name of the step. Can be omitted.
type - The type of the step. If omitted, defaults to 'run'
tag - A pattern matching tags or branches this step and any of its children should be run against. Defaults to always running.
exclude - A pattern matching tags or branches on which this step should NOT be run. Defaults to empty.
service - The service name defined in codeship-services.yml this step will run on
command - The command to be run in this step. Required with and can only be used with the 'run' type or no specified type
image_name - The image name this push step should push to. Required with and only used by the push step
image_tag - The image tag this push step should push to. See https://docs.cloudbees.com/docs/cloudbees-codeship/latest/pro-builds-and-configuration/steps#_push_steps for details. Only used by the push step
registry - The image registry this push step should push to. For Docker Hub, use https://registry-1.docker.io. Required with and only used by the push step
encrypted_dockercfg_path - The location of a Docker configuration file encrypted by Jet to be used with this step. Optional.
dockercfg_service - The name of a service defined in codeship-services.yml that provides the Docker configuration. Optional.
services A list of service names defined in codeship-services.yml that will be used for this step.
#
Values
Actions
{{$index+1}}.
steps A list of steps to run within this step or on_fail group. Cannot be used with 'run', 'push', or 'load' steps
#
name
type
tag
exclude
service
command
image_name
image_tag
registry
encrypted_dockercfg_path
Actions
{{$index+1}}.
{{row.name}}
{{row.type}}
{{row.tag}}
{{row.exclude}}
{{row.service}}
{{row.command}}
{{row.image_name}}
{{row.image_tag}}
{{row.registry}}
{{row.encrypted_dockercfg_path}}
on_fail An optional list of steps to run if this step fails.
#
name
type
tag
exclude
service
command
image_name
image_tag
registry
encrypted_dockercfg_path
Actions
{{$index+1}}.
{{row.name}}
{{row.type}}
{{row.tag}}
{{row.exclude}}
{{row.service}}
{{row.command}}
{{row.image_name}}
{{row.image_tag}}
{{row.registry}}
{{row.encrypted_dockercfg_path}}
Download Json
{{message}}